#60b6a3 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#60b6a3 is composed of 37.6% red, 71.4% green and 63.9%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 47.3% cyan, 0% magenta, 10.4% yellow and 28.6% black. It has a hue angle of 166.7 degrees, a saturation of 37.1% and a lightness of 54.5%. #60b6a3 color hex could be obtained by blending #c0ffff with #006d47. Closest websafe color is: #66cc99.

Shades and Tints of #60b6a3

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#010202 is the darkest color, while #f4faf9 is the lightest one.
